Julián Quiñones is a Colombian-born forward who spent the bulk of his career in Liga MX — most notably at Tigres and Atlas — before naturalizing as a Mexican citizen and committing to El Tri. A pacy, direct winger with good finishing instincts, he was one of the more dangerous attackers in Mexican football during his Atlas years. His move to Club América and then Saudi Arabia's Al Qadsiah followed his international switch, which generated significant debate in Colombia. For Mexico, he adds pace and directness to the attack, though his naturalization path means he carries extra scrutiny every time he plays.
